SPDIF can carry:
2 channels PCM (uncompressed)
5.1 compressed signal (AC3, E_AC3 and DTS)

Amazon Prime is currently offering AC3 or E_AC3 depending on the source so you should get what you want using SPDIF if the Amazon App you're using offers it
